Monday, November 24, 2008

Tatsunoko vs. Capcom - Japan TV spot

Japanese TV, you gotta love it.... Hopefully this game will sell in Japan.


Anonymous said...

That was so quick and punchy, I bet even Japanese people had trouble keeping up with the words!


Travis Hendricks said...

This only reminds me of the total absence of Mega Man in Brawl. What a disappointment that was.

This game looks pretty cool though.